Transaction 8742d267dcfdbe98ba615b08e03b15848eaab16aca71189beed03cb9b4566132

1 Input
2 Outputs
  • 8742d267dcfdbe98ba615b08e03b15848eaab16aca71189beed03cb9b4566132:0
  • value  509950325
    address  2NBMEXyYNtMs7PinhyFeu75Cj8NH7o3ctPQ
  • 8742d267dcfdbe98ba615b08e03b15848eaab16aca71189beed03cb9b4566132:1
  • value  335100627046
    address  mwizimcbgnJnqdFK5svwk56r2fB36WNBMf